Subject: Proposed "Meridian" Subscription Tier

Team,

Ahead of Friday's executive session, please review the attached model for the Meridian tier on our Lanternbox platform. Pricing sits between Standard and Enterprise, bundling analytics and priority support. Margin impact is modest but retention upside is significant per the Ashgrove pilot. Department heads should flag resourcing concerns before launch planning begins. The strategic context appears in the confidential note below.

confidential, kagep-kahof: Druokax Systems plans to lower the Ulaath list price by 53 percent in March.

Hi team — quick note from the front desk at Wrenhall House. An engineer from Opaline Systems will need after-hours access to the server room on Thursday evening, roughly 21:00 to midnight. Please log their arrival, confirm photo ID, and escort them to Level 2. The server room door takes the code below.

turnstile pass: bdg-CBZJZ-47271

## Getting Started: PortionPal

Hey! PortionPal is our recipe-scaling calculator — users paste a recipe, pick a serving count, and we do the fraction math. Most review action happens in `scaler/core.py`, where unit conversions live. Run `make dev` to boot the app and seed a few sample recipes. The seeder needs to reach the local ingredients database, so set it up with the connection string below.

replica DSN, tawef-hahap: mysql://eliix_svc:FiIC0jz@db-394a.lumiclabs.internal:5432/holius

## Splitting the User Module

Welcome aboard. Your first task at Drossel Systems is carving the user module out of the Pindlehart monolith. Start with the profile endpoints; they have the fewest cross-cutting dependencies. The authentication paths move last. All extracted services register with the Fennwick gateway before cutover. To access the migration staging environment for the first time, you'll need the recovery passphrase listed below.

vault phrase of tajeg-tageg = pelix-druix-holius-briael-zorwyn-frawyn-fraox-norok-drueth-aldiel